Right now we have a lot of devices reporting syslogs into splunk. I'd really like to be able to search them by hostname or IP address. Is there a way to get both the IP address and the DNS lookup of the device into Splunk for the same syslog message?

For instance if I have a device located at 172.16.57.1 and it's in DNS as YUM-CA-FW, then it would be nice to search for this device either way:
host_ip="172.16.57.1"
or
host_name="YUM-CA-FW"

Is this possible?

If it is, can I take it a step further and have both a host_realIP and host_natIP?
